Question:

The rectangle has an area of x² - 144 meters and a length of x + 12 meters. What expression represents the width of the rectangle?

Given:

Area of rectangle = (x² - 144) m²

Length = (x + 12) m

To find:

Width = B

Answer:

(x - 12) meters.

Solution:

We know,

Area of rectangle = Length × Breadth(Width)

 ({x}^{2}  - 144) = (x + 12)  \times B  \\  \\ (x - 12) (x + 12) = (x + 12) \times B  \\  \\ \dfrac{(x - 12) \cancel{( x+ 12)}}{\cancel{(x+ 12)}} = B \\ \\ B = (x - 12)

Therefore, width of the rectangle is (x - 12) meters.

Identity used:

a² - b² = (a + b) (a - b)
